  • Title

    Pulse shaping and compression in nonlinear periodic structures with unbalanced Kerr coefficients

  • Abstract
    We validate our model with experimental results in a periodic structure consisting of one linear and one resonant nonlinear materials. We show a maximum of 28% pulse compression in both transmitted and reflected pulses.
